If you're a crafter, scrapbooker, mixed media fanatic, then I know for sure you never throw everything away. An empty bottle, button, old coins , etc. etc. You'll allways save it for later for using on your mixed media projects. Even bubble wrap I keep it to, to use it for painting and stamping the canvas.

With the above products, I try to make a combination aimed at Autumn or Winter or Christmas. I have everything still lay on the canvas and then the inspiration comes naturally.
Try also to look at everything together and let your canvas in the meanwhile dry. We will soon adhesives and bonding and finishing it. The smaller the canvas is, the less material you need. Good luck figuring out or shopping.
